Try this, he said to his co-workers at the conference table, write down something about an elephantand try to write the same thing that you think the others will. Several different answers came up its grey, its bigbut two people wrote it has a trunk. Mark Goodson was intrigued with the concept of a game where there were no right or wrong answers and only matching answers scored points. and on November 2006, Miller and Law separated.
